Taking full advantage of being based in London, the College organises excursions to musicals, art galleries, museums, concerts, and famous historical landmarks. The activities programme has been especially designed for our students to be able to participate in social activities whilst exploring the city.
Students have also taken part in trips which have enhanced their understanding within subjects – having travelled to Poland with the Holocaust Educational Trust and the Shakespeare’s Globe theatre in London for History, the Houses of Parliament for Politics or the Tate Modern for Art and Photography.
During school holidays we also organise regular study trips around the UK and further afield. In recent years some of our students travelled to China for a four-week expedition exploring the country. Most recently, in February 2019, a group of students travelled to Boston with a group of our A Level students to participate in the MIT Model United Nations Conference. Ealing Independent College was the only school from the UK to participate.
